Finance committee approves $1.16 million parks and recreation facility renovation contract
The Appleton City Finance Committee voted unanimously to award the Parks and Recreation Facility Renovation Project contract to Blue Sky Contractors LLC for $1,073,103, with an 8% contingency of $85,848, for a total not to exceed $1,158,951. The committee also approved budget amendments moving $86,000 from the 2025 Parks Hardscape capital-improvement program to the renovation project.

Alder Hartzheim noted a strong response from the contracting market for this project, saying eight general contractors and about 50 subcontractors submitted interest, which he described as an indicator the market is softening. No alder opposed the award; the vote passed 5-0.

The action includes the specified contingency and the one-time budget transfer; committee members did not request further study before awarding the contract.
